Dale - quick question, with both my head and block skimmed/decked, the surfaces have a thin smear of light oil on them, before I mount the two together (cometic HG/ARP Studs) I assume both surfaces need to be totally dry?

Baz a quick wipe with a blue paper towel and some brake cleaner will do the job.
